Huntington Ingalls Industries Long Term Debt 2012-2026 | HII

Huntington Ingalls Industries long term debt from 2012 to 2026. Long term debt can be defined as the sum of all long term debt fields.
  • Huntington Ingalls Industries long term debt for the quarter ending June 30, 2026 was $2.702B, a 0.07% increase year-over-year.
  • Huntington Ingalls Industries long term debt for 2025 was $2.7B, a 0% decline from 2024.
  • Huntington Ingalls Industries long term debt for 2024 was $2.7B, a 21.95% increase from 2023.
  • Huntington Ingalls Industries long term debt for 2023 was $2.214B, a 11.65% decline from 2022.

Huntington Ingalls Industries, Inc. is America?s largest military shipbuilding company and a provider of professional services to partners in government and industry. Its Ingalls Shipbuilding segment (Ingalls) and Newport News Shipbuilding segment (Newport News) have built more ships in more ship classes than any other U.S. naval shipbuilder. Its Technical Solutions segment provides a range of services to government and commercial customers. It conducts most of its business with the U.S. Government, primarily the Department of Defense (DoD). As prime contractor, it participates in many high-priority U.S. defense programs. Ingalls includes its non-nuclear ship design, construction, repair, and maintenance businesses. Newport News includes all of the company's nuclear ship design, construction, overhaul, refueling, and repair and maintenance businesses. It also provides a wide range of professional services, including defense and federal solutions, nuclear and environmental services, and unmanned systems.
